Rdzeń Cortex-M3 znalazł zastosowanie w nowych mikrokontrolerach firmy Analog Devices: ADuCM36x. W artykule przedstawiamy opracowany w naszym laboratorium prosty, zgodny z formatem mechanicznym Arduino, zestaw wyposażony w mikrokontroler ADuCM360, a także opis niezbędnych narzędzi programistycznych, sposoby programowania pamięci Flash i przykładowy projekt wzorcowy.
Odtworzenie bootloadera w Arduino Uno z wykorzystaniem programatora AVRISP mkII
Jeżeli dotknie nas uszkodzenie mikrokontrolera na płytce Arduino Uno lub dziwnym trafem z pamięci Flash naszego układu „zniknie” bootloader, próba ponownego zaprogramowania jego pamięci zakończy się niepowodzeniem i komunikatem o błędzie. Jak sobie poradzić z taką sytuacją – piszemy w artykule.
Pierwsze uruchomienie DFRobot Romeo
Silniki należy podłączyć do odpowiednich złącz na płytce (zielone śrubowe, obok diod schottky’ego). Następnie należy podłączyć zasilacz (np. 9 V, 800 mA) lub baterie, potem kabel USB…
Język programowania Arduino – jedyny słuszny wybór
Decyzja dotycząca wyboru języka programowania w świecie Arduino z pewnością nie była łatwa. Od wielu już lat jedynym słusznym wyborem dla systemów mikroprocesorowych jest język C, który dzięki wysokiej efektywności i elastyczności wyparł asembler z ogromnej większości projektów. Tylko, że język C ma opinię trudnego do nauczenia (bzdura!), a przecież z założeń Arduino wynika, że praca ma być łatwa i przyjemna. Jednak również w tym przypadku autorzy Arduino stanęli na wysokości zadania.
Kompatybilna z Arduino i Raspberry Pi płytka uruchomieniowa z mikrokontrolerem STM32
Portal element14 zaprezentował płytkę Embedded Pi, dzięki której możliwe jest tworzenie projektów integrujących trzy popularne platformy sprzętowe: płytki Arduino, komputer Raspberry Pi oraz mikrokontroler STM32.
Tania płytka uruchomieniowa w formacie Arduino dla układów PSoC 4
Krótko po przedstawieniu przez firmę Cypress nowej serii układów PSoC 4 producent poinformował o pierwszej dedykowanej dla nich płytce uruchomieniowej o nazwie PSoC 4 Pioneer Kit.
Zestaw z płytką Freescale Freedom i Arduino Proto Shield
Firma Farnell element14 oferuje zestaw FRDMKL25Z PROTO BUNDLE składający się z płytki uruchomieniowej Freescale Freedom KL25Z oraz płytki Arduino Proto Shield.
Płytka Arduino z modułem GSM/GPRS
Z pomocą płytki „Arduino GSM Shield” użytkownicy platformy Arduino mogą tworzyć aplikacje korzystające z usług sieci telefonii komórkowej takich jak inicjowanie i odbieranie połączeń głosowych, wysyłanie i odbieranie wiadomości tekstowych SMS oraz korzystanie z sieci Internet przez GPRS.
FREEDOM-KL05Z – nowy „budżetowy” zestaw Freescale dla Kinetis L
Firma Freescale wprowadza do sprzedaży kolejny zestaw ewaluacyjny z serii Freedom – FRDM-KL05Z, wyposażony w 32-bitowy mikrokontroler z serii Kinetis L (rdzeń Cortex-M0+).
Freescale Freedom KL25Z: „Arduino” na 32 bitach
Freedom KL25Z to doskonale wyposażony zestaw startowy z pierwszym na rynku mikrokontrolerem wyposażonym w rdzeń Cortex-M0+. To dopiero początek jego zalet: jest także mechanicznie zgodny z Arduino, ma ponadto wbudowany programator-debugger z USB, kolejną zaletą jest jego niska cena. Niższa niż wersje z 8-bitowymi AVR-ami…